About Thomas Neubauer

Thomas Neubauer is a scholar working on Software, Information Systems and Management Information Systems, having authored 123 papers that have together received 1.5k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Information and Cyber Security (23 papers), Icing and De-icing Technologies (13 papers) and Cloud Data Security Solutions (12 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Management Information Systems (234 citations), Information Systems (495 citations) and Software (62 citations). Thomas Neubauer has collaborated with scholars based in Austria, Germany and United Kingdom. Frequent co-authors include Johannes Heurix, Stefan Fenz, Andreas Ekelhart, Christian Stummer, Bernhard Riedl, Stefan Biffl, Peter Zimmermann, Patrick Claus F. Eggers, Michael Wagner and Edgar Weippl. Their work appears in journals such as S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ología, Expert Systems with Applications and Remote Sensing.
